THEME: ACCOMPLICE TO SIN?

Memorise:
Who knowing The Judgement of God, that they which commit such things are worthy of death, not only do the same, but have pleasure in them that do them. Romans 1:32

Read: Romans 1:29-32
29. Being filled with all unrighteousness, fornication, wickedness, covetousness, maliciousness; full of envy, murder, debate, deceit, malignity; whisperers,
30. Backbiters, haters of God, despiteful, proud, boasters, inventors of evil things, disobedient to parents,
31. Without understanding, covenantbreakers, without natural affection, implacable, unmerciful:
32. Who knowing The Judgment of God, that they which commit such things are worthy of death, not only do the same, but have pleasure in them that do them.

Message:
In trying to rationalise and condone certain types of sin, some people have painted them in different colours.
1. Take lying for instance.
2. This evil act has been categorised by some into white, black and so on.
3. Whether it is a grave lie or a lie that cannot hurt a fly, a lie is a lie.
4. Leviticus 19:11 says it is wrong to lie to other brethren.
5. The devil is the father of all liars according to our Lord Jesus Christ (John 8:44).
6.  John 8:44
Ye are of your father the devil, and the lusts of your father ye will do. He was a murderer from the beginning, and abode not in the truth, because there is no truth in him. When he speaketh a lie, he speaketh of his own: for he is a liar, and the father of it.
7. If you wilfully engage in lies, you definitely have the devil as your father.

B. The Bible declares that outside the gates of Heavens are liars:
1.  “For without are dogs, and sorcerers, and whoremongers, and murderers, and idolaters, and whosoever loveth and maketh a lie.” Revelation 22:15
2. If a lie is as trivial as people say it is, why would liars be categorised with fornicators, murderers and idol worshippers?
3. If a lie is not grievous, why would the gated of Heaven be shut against liars?
4. Also, in the above Scripture, a distinction is made between those who love lies and those who tell the lies.
5. In other words, some people are branded liars and not because they told a lie, but because they are in accomplice to a lie.
6. If you cover up someone who has lied, you are an accessory to the lie and as a result, a liar yourself.

C. We understand from our memory verse that while two people may commit a particular sin, ten others may be punished along with them for complicity.
1. This is why you must be very careful.
2. In the process of recommending someone for ordination for example, the fellow may lie that he is a house fellowship leader and provide an address, whereas he is not.
3. If his pastor knows the truth but turns a blind eye and goes ahead to present such a candidate for ordination, he has become an accomplice to a lie and might be on his way to Hell unless he repents.
4. This goes for everyone who knows the truth but cover it up.
5. Do not be taken over by the sin of others! 6. If some people choose to sin, let them face its consequences all by themselves.    7. Never support, sponsor or encourage anyone over sinful act.
8. You must be able to tell the fellow that he or she has sinned and condemn that action with all gravity.
9. Never become the pillow on which the sinner will find solace whenever he or she wants to sin, or else, you will partake of divine judgement and end up in Hell together.  

Key Point:
A lot of people will go to Hell because they take pleasure in those who sin.

THEME: LOVE MUST BE RECIPROCATED

Memorise:
If ye keep My commandments, ye shall abide in My Love; even as I have kept My Father’s Commandments, and abide in His Love. John 15:10

Read: John 15:9-10
9. As The Father hath loved me, so have I loved you: continue ye in My Love.
10 If ye keep My commandments, ye shall abide in My Love; even as I have kept My Father’s Commandments, and abide in His Love.

Message:
A. God loves us so much the He gave us Himself as a gift.
1. Giving Jesus Christ to die for us was the same as giving Himself to us (1Timothy 3:16).
2. 1 Timothy 3:16
And without controversy great is the mystery of godliness: God was manifest in the flesh, justified in the Spirit, seen of angels, preached unto the Gentiles, believed on in the world, received up into glory.
3. But He did not stop there, He went further, pointing out to us in Romans 8:32 that:
“He that spared not His own Son, but delivered Him up for us all, how shall He not with Him also freely give us all things.”
4. However, love should be a two-way exchange, and not one-sided.
5. If you love someone and your love is not being reciprocated, after a while, something will happen to that love.
6. That love may grow cold or even die.
7. The same applies to the relationship between God and us.
8. If you check through the scriptures, you will learn that whenever God does something for someone, He expects them to do something in return.

B. It is one thing to be loved and another thing to abide in that love.
1. While you were in your sins, God demonstrated His Love for you by sending Himself, in the person of Jesus Christ, to die for you.
2. When you respond to this divine initiative by repenting of your sins and accepting Jesus as your Lord and Saviour, you will be washed by His blood and forgiven.
3. After this, God increases His love towards you, and when you reciprocate, that love increases.
4. Love begets greater love.
If you want to sustain or increase The Love that God has for you, reciprocate His Love. 5.  In today’s reading, Jesus tells us that when He came to earth as a man, He was loved by the Father; but to sustain that love, He had to keep The Father’s Commandments.

C. What The Father expected of Jesus is what He expects of us today.
1. There is no way you will continue in God’s love when you deliberately break His commandments or refuses to obey Him.
2. If He has loved you, He expects you to love Him too.
3. He expects your obedience.
4. He also expects you to love other brethren.
5. How have you reciprocated The Love of The Lord?
6. Even though afflictions, persecutions, angels, Satan, what we see and what we can’t see cannot separate us from The Love of God in Christ Jesus (Romans 8:35-39)!
7. Disobedience, manifested by violation of His word, can deal that love a terrible blow.

THEME: RETURN REDUCED WAGES!

Memorise:
"Owe no man any thing, but to love one another: for he that loveth another hath fulfilled The Law." Romans 13:8

Read: Genesis 31:36-42
36. And Jacob was wroth, and chode with Laban: and Jacob answered and said to Laban, What is my trespass? What is my sin, that thou hast so hotly pursued after me?
37. Whereas thou hast searched all my stuff, what hast thou found of all thy household stuff? Set it here before my brethren and thy brethren, that they may judge betwixt us both.
38. This twenty years have I been with thee; thy ewes and thy she goats have not cast their young, and the rams of thy flock have I not eaten.
39. That which was torn of beasts I brought not unto thee; I bare the loss of it; of my hand didst thou require it, whether stolen by day, or stolen by night.
40. Thus I was; in the day the drought consumed me, and the frost by night; and my sleep departed from mine eyes.
41. Thus have I been twenty years in thy house; I served thee fourteen years for thy two daughters, and six years for thy cattle: and thou hast changed my wages ten times.
42. Except The God of my father, The God of Abraham, and the fear of Isaac, had been with me, surely thou hadst sent me away now empty. God hath seen mine affliction and the labour of my hands, and rebuked thee yesternight.

Message:
A. God is a righteous God, and as a result, He hates all forms of fraud.
1. According to Leviticus 19:13, it is a crime to delay your worker's salary for 24 hours.
2. Leviticus 19:13
"Thou shalt not defraud thy neighbour, neither rob him: the wages of him that is hired shall not abide with thee all night until the morning."
3. Do you promptly pay your staff – whether church or secular?
4. Another aspect of fraud is manipulating your workers’ salaries.

B. One Bible character who was a victim of this was Jacob.
1. All the years he worked for Laban, he suffered a great deal.
2. He was deceived, cheated, made to bear the losses his boss should have borne and earned an ever-decreasing wage.
3. Laban was extremely wicked.
4. But do you know that some employers today are like Laban?
5. They take all the gains of their businesses and push all the losses to their staff, irrespective of what caused such losses.     6. Also, while they plan to make more profit and push their staff to work hard at it, they hardly ever plan to increase their salaries.
7. If anything, they continue to come up with excuses as to why such salaries should remain at the same level, or even be reduced.

C. Laban reduced Jacob’s wages 10 times.
1. If you are happy to cut down your staff salaries rather than increase them, though your business is not diminishing, you are toying with Hell.
2. If your business cannot afford an employee anymore, it is better to let such staff go after paying their entitlements.
3. Take note of The Words of Romans 13:8:
“Owe no man any thing, but to love one another. For he that loveth another hath fulfilled The law.”
4. Every cent, kobo or penny you fraudulent cut off the wages of your staff amounts to a debt you owe them.
5. Also, the fact that you owe your staff shows your lack of love for them. 
6. You cannot be cutting down the salary or wages of those you love, while your business is doing fine.

D. Do not be surprised that some employers who claim to be believers in Christ will die and get to the gate of Heaven, only to be told that they cannot enter in because of the debt they owe their staff.
1. At that checkpoint, the entire amount owed will be found on them.
2. They will then say “I am sorry; I am now prepared to pay the debts I owe my staff”, but the angles will say “Sorry, it’s too late.”
3. The money such persons fraudulently stole from their staff will follow them to Hell-fire and torment them there for eternity.
4. For your own good, go and restitute all the wages you have cut off without just cause!

Key Point:
Besides pride, another vice that God cannot stand in people is breaking of agreements. If you make a promise, you must keep it.
